An editor, web ed and production journalist with nearly 20 years' experience of working with some of the biggest rock titles in the UK - Kerrang!, Classic Rock, MOJO, Uncut, Q and Metal Hammer - Jo is currently Album Reviews Editor for Prog magazine, columnist for Classic Rock, contributor to Electronic Sound, freelance sub for Empire and a Module Leader for three courses in Journalism at BIMM London. She is one fifth of the rotating Prog mag Progcast team.
Specialist areas
Bios and social media plus news, reviews and features about 60s guitar rock, 70s prog and electronica, 80s indie, 90s grunge and Britpop, modern alternative punk, extreme metal, kraut, experimental and psych - with a healthy dash of vintage folk and easy listening. I'm also drawn to record shops and people's music stashes like a rock moth to a flame; this had led to me bothering a bunch of non-music celebrities (from Bill Bailey to Ben Wheatley to Ian Rankin) over the last ten years for a regular feature in Prog called My Record Collection.
